Here's my recently acquired 661. I intercepted it from the Salvation Army donation area last week when I was making a donation. It was filthy with cigarette tar, 2 dial lights were out, and it had a significant hum on all inputs with no volume.

I cleaned it all up, replaced some lamps, reflowed a couple cold solder joints, removed a partially melted 45 record adapter from one of the emitter resistors, another emitter resistor was melted to the connector to the driver board so I freed it up and gently bent it away from the connector.

Finally, I removed the driver board and cleaned up the contacts and reseated it. This took care of the hum. I must say I'm impressed at the sound coming from this little 20 watter, it sounds great with plenty of bass and clarity.
